The alarm has signalled it’s time to get up. Often, our brain takes it as the signal to immediately begin thinking about all the things we need to do today!
Before we have even pulled back those nice warm covers, our minds are already skipping ahead to today’s staff meeting, or the unfinished project that’s waiting, or the need to stop at the supermarket on the way to work.
Stop.
Breathe.
You have a choice right now.
What you think about in the precious few moments before getting out of bed sets the tone for your whole morning and possibly the rest of your day.
Before thinking about all that you need to do, try thinking about what you value.
It starts by firstly recognising your personal values. How do you want to exist in the world? Do you value kindness? Love? Respect? Honesty? Laughter? Authenticity? If you’re not exactly sure what your personal values are, consider the adjectives you would like to hear a friend use to describe you. Would you like to hear that you are kind? Loving? Genuine? Trustworthy? Fun to be around? Adventurous? Faithful?
We only get one day at a time.
So each morning, take a moment to consider how you want to be today.
Sure, you will also need to think about what you need to do for the day ahead, but for now, it can wait. Right now, before you get out of bed, just take a few seconds and choose to think about the specific value you want to live by today.
Just one.
Perhaps one of your personal values is being a loving person. So before getting out of bed, ask yourself, “How can I be loving today?” What is one specific small actionable thing that I can do to show someone today that I am a loving person? It might be the decision to give your spouse an unexpected hug, or to text an encouragement to a friend as you eat your breakfast, or to wave at the neighbour over the road whose ususally backing out of their driveway at the same time as you.
You get the idea.
A small, simple choice toward values-driven, committed action that you play out in your mind before you even get out of bed.
Be clear, be confident and don’t overthink it. Just choose one value you want to live by today. Once this choice becomes a morning habit before you get out of bed, it can make a world of difference in improving your mood at the very start of each day.
So I encourage you to choose how you want to be today, and intentionally sprinkle that one specific value throughout your day.
If you’re like me, you may need a reminder. Write it on your hand if you need to! But commit to action and just do it.
